From:
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
Bind·er
n.
1.
One
who
binds
;
as
,
a
binder
of
sheaves
;
one
whose
trade
is
to
bind
;
as
,
a
binder
of
books
.
2.
Anything
that
binds
,
as
a
fillet
,
cord
,
rope
,
or
band
;
a
bandage
; --
esp
.
the
principal
piece
of
timber
intended
to
bind
together
any
building
.

From:
WordNet (r) 2.0
binder
n
1:
a
machine
that
cuts
grain
and
binds
it
in
sheaves
[
syn
: {
reaper
binder
]
2:
something
used
to
bind
separate
particles
together
or
facilitate
adhesion
to
a
surface
3:
holds
loose
papers
or
magazines
[
syn
:
ring-binder
]
4:
something
used
to
tie
or
bind
[
syn
:
ligature
]
